You can use hydrogen peroxide to whiten your teeth. To safely use hydrogen peroxide, pour a small amount into the bottle cap and dip your toothbrush into it. Brush gently and avoid gums for a couple minutes. Follow up by brushing with your regular toothpaste.
Flossing is just as important as brushing your teeth. If you do not floss after every meal, bacteria will build up between your teeth and damage them. Take a few minutes to floss after you eat, and you will notice a difference. Your teeth will look whiter after a few months of flossing on a regular basis.
Oral hygiene is essential, even without natural teeth. Always be sure and clean your dentures, the same way you would if they were real teeth. It's also vital to utilize a scraper for your tongue or brush it to eliminate bacteria that gives you bad breath.

Check your tooth paste labels. You should always choose toothpaste which contains fluoride. Additional ingredients usually contain abrasive elements meant to whiten teeth. If your gums are too sensitive to your toothpaste, find a product that contains fewer of these chemicals.
Never assume that skipping your dental appointment is okay. Everyone should start getting dental care as soon as they are six months old. Dental check-ups should be done every six months after. This holds true for children, teenagers, adults and the elderly. Everyone needs to see a dentist twice a year past their first birthday.
If you are a smoker, you need to stop smoking for a healthy mouth. Smoking has been linked to oral cancer, tooth discoloration, bad breath and tooth decay. The best thing that you can do for the health of your mouth is to quit smoking.

Be realistic about your expectations for whitening toothpastes. The compounds and abrasives they contain are often very helpful at lightening the surface stains on your teeth, such as coffee stains. However, they are not going to address more serious issues like decay or stains that have penetrated the tooth enamel. Most dental experts agree that it is safe to use such toothpastes twice a day.
Stick with a children's toothpaste for your kids. Small children often swallow toothpaste instead of spitting it out. To avoid illness, they should use only non-toxic, fluoride-free formulas. As your children age, their toothpaste can be switched to one that is more appropriate for them. Double checking the packaging can save you from accidentally harming your child.
Eat healthy fruits and vegetables to help keep teeth cleaned naturally. The natural abrasive qualities of fibrous fruits and vegetables, such as apples and carrots, help to break down and remove sticky plaque from teeth and gum lines. Follow your dentist's orders as closely as you can, especially if you need dental work or antibiotics. Oral infections can spread quickly if they aren't addressed in a timely manner. Always do what your dentist says to treat your infection, including buying antibiotics and using them as long as you ought.

Choosing a toothbrush that has the proper bristles for your needs is important. Ideally bristles should be firm enough to remove plaque but not so firm that they irritate and damage your gums. Whether you choose angled bristles or straight bristles is a personal choice and depends on which type you feel works best.
Brush your teeth three times daily, for about two minutes every brushing. Brushing your teeth at regular intervals can help prevent the development of cavities and gum disease. Do you spend enough time on brushing and flossing? A lot of people brush their teeth too quickly. You should take the time to brush each tooth for at least thirty seconds. Keep track of how much time you spend on brushing and flossing to make sure you are doing it properly.
Chew some sugarless gum after each meal. The motion of chewing encourages the production of saliva which works as a wash for your teeth. Any sugars from foods that you have eaten can effectively be washed away. This is a good way to keep your teeth clean between meals if you cannot brush.
